Furniture Manufacturing Company Management - Essay Example Company Act 2006 Sec 177 requires all directors of a company to avoid conflicts of interest by declaring their interest in a proposed arrangement or transaction. Such declaration must be made by a written notice, a general notice or in a meeting of the directors. Company Act 2006 under Sec 182 (1) requires the directors to declare their interest in any transaction or arrangement that has been entered in to by the company whether direct interest or indirect interest in a transaction. In the above case, Tom has contravened Company Law provisions on duty to disclose conflict of interest in awarding Computers4Us the ICT contract. Section 175 (1) which deals with conflict of interest requires all directors to avoid all situations which have either direct or interest which conflicts or may conflict with the interest of the company. The above case is a situational conflict of interest since Tom’s father is the owner of Computers4Us which will lead to transactional conflict since Tom is in a position to benefit from the ICT contract. Tom is criminally liable for breach of Company Act to avoid conflict of interest thus is liable to a fine. While Company Act 2006 does not give a definition of â€Å"interest†, the duty to avoid conflict of interest will apply in situations that can lead to exploitation of information, opportunities and company property. Tom is both an executive director and significant shareholder in Imperial Ltd and his connection with Computers4Us has the potential may be adverse to the Imperial Ltd interests since it will influence the decisions made by the company. Although not expressly included in Company Act 2006, Tom should have declared his interest in Computers4Us since the term â€Å"connected† in the Act is wide enough to include spouses, step-children, director’s parents and civil partners of the directors. Tom and Harry are both executive directors and shareholders of Imperial Ltd. Possibly; Tom’s sharehold ing influenced the decision to award Computers4Us the ICT contract. Tom as an executive director is fully aware that his father owns Computers4Us. In the above case, Tom should have declared his conflict of interest and the fact that his father owns Computers4Us to the board of directors either during the meetings, in writing or by just a general notice. Harry is free to sue for the cancelation of the contract since it contravenes the provisions of Company Act 2006 (Worthington and Sealy 2007). For private companies formed before 1st October 2008, the directors have not automatic powers to approve any conflict of interest unless they amend the articles of association or pass a resolution to grant the directors such powers. For private companies formed on or after October 1st 2008, the board of directors has the powers to authorize a conflict of interest unless it is invalidated by the articles of association of the company (Davies 2010). However, in deciding to authorize the above c onflict of interest, the directors of any private company must comply with Company Act 2006 provisions including the duty to promote and safeguard the welfare of the company. Red Meat and Protein Avitta Olivero    Red meat as a source of protein Introduction Meat and processed meat products are a vital source of protein, lipids and other nutritionally important functional constituents which are essential components in a human diet. The two main categories of meat are red and white meat. As per nutritional concepts, the red meat is referred to as the one which is reddish in appearance in raw state and has an elevated myoglobin content in it. Red meat category which is highly consumed by humans include beef, lamb, pork and processed meat products. White meat is the one with a pale appearance and mainly includes poultry, veal and rabbit. Protein are macromolecules which are composed of long chains of amino acids and are referred to as the building block of the body as it is present in every single cell in the human body. It is vital to include protein containing food in the diet as it essential for major functions include growth and repair and is a major energy source of the body. Among the different food stuffs meat and meat products supplies the necessary protein in human diet. Protein is present in both the vegetarian and non-vegetarian food. As per the New Zealand nutrition foundation animal food as well as plant sources such as soya and quinoa supplies the essential amino acids which are important for the body functions. This essay specifically focusses on analysing the importance of Red meat as a source of protein. Literature review Nutrient profile of meat A critical analysis on the nutritional composition of any food is essential for any study on human nutrition. Meat has become an integral part of human diet. Meat is a complex structured food which includes components of biological value such as micronutrients (minerals and vitamins), proteins, fats and low level of carbohydrates. As Per the Food Standards Australia New Zealand the meat includes the flesh with skeletal muscle and fat as well as offal which include the internal organs of the animal. Meat comprises about 75 % moisture content 20 % protein, 3 % lipid and 2 % soluble non-proteinaceous compounds (Briggs Schweigert, 1990). Meat serves as a vital source of proteins, vitamins such as vitamin B6, B12 and vitamin D, Omega-3 unsaturated fatty acids and minor levels of trace elements such as zinc, iron, phosphorus, bioactive compounds like carnitine, carnosine, ubiquinone and several antioxidant compounds. All these nutritional contents of meat make it an essential component of human diet (Williams, 2007). Importance of Protein in human diet   Ã‚   Proteins are nitrogenous compounds which are constituted of amino acids. There are about twenty aminoacids which are vital for the growth and other cellular functions. Amino acids are mainly categorised in two: essential and non-essential aminoacids. Non-essential aminoacids are those which can be synthesized by the body and those which cannot be synthesized by the human body and supplied via the diet are essential amino acids (Hoffman Falvo, 2004).Animal protein is the appropriate source of protein as it includes the essential amino acid content in it and hence it is essential to in include animal based food in the diet. Animal based food include meat and meat products (Pighin et al., 2016). Red Meat protein Meat is composed of higher concentration of proteins which includes the structural proteins such as myofibrillar protein, sarcoplasmic proteins and proteins that are present in connective tissue such as collagen and elastin (Pighin et al., 2016). Meat is a complete source of protein as it includes all essential amino acids such as lysine, threonine, methionine, phenylalanine, tryptophan, leucine, isoleucine, valine. Protein concentration differs in both raw and cooked meat as the nutrients get more concentrated during cooking process due to the depletion of water content in the meat and the meat proteins exhibit higher digestibility ratio. As per the studies, 100g of raw red meat contain about 20-25% of protein whereas in 100g of cooked red meat the protein content is about 28-36% as the protein profile is modified after the cooking process. Beef and pork are considered to have the highest protein content in them. The U. S Dietary Reference Intake (USDRI) recommend a daily intake of 0.8g/kg of protein for adults which is the basic requirement for the proper functioning of the body and this prescribed intake rate of protein by USDRI lowers the incidence of cardiovascular diseases, osteoporosis and diabetes particularly type-2 diabetes (McNeill, 2014). Evaluation of meat protein quality Protein digestibility corrected amino acid score(PDCAAS) is a standard methodology recommended by world health organization and food and agriculture organization (FAO/WHO) to estimate the protein quality. In this method the protein quality is estimated by expressing the content of the first limiting essential amino acid of the test protein as a percentage of the content of the same amino acid content in a reference pattern of essential amino acids (FAO/WHO, 1990). The resultant value obtained by this method was taken as the protein digestibility corrected amino acid score (PDCAAS) and highest possible score in this method is 1.0. As per the PDCAAS method the protein quality score of red meat is estimated to be 0.9 whereas the protein quality score is between 0.5-0.7 for plant based food. According to Schaafsma, the protein digestibility corrected amino acid score is considered to the reliable method for estimating the quality of proteins consumed in the human diet (Williams, 2007). The fatty acid content in red meat are saturated in nature because the unsaturated fatty acid is transformed to saturated form by the microbes present in the rumen. The major saturated fatty acids present in red meat are palmitic and stearic acid. (Gerber, 2007) Minerals and trace elements The major minerals which are prevalent in red meat are the iron and zinc. The highest concentration of these minerals is observed in beef and pork meat(Williams, 2007).The iron content present in red meat is the heme iron rather than the non-heme iron contained in plant based foods. The heme iron is readily absorbed by the human body and this absorption rate is enhanced by the protein present in red meat. In meat, the factors such as phytate, tannin, oxalate and fibres are absent in red meat which can adversely affect the iron absorption rate. Similarly, the zinc absorption from animal based food is relatively higher than that from plant based food stuffs. (Ford Caspersen, 2012) Demerits: Previous studies reveal people with excess intake of red meat have been found to have higher cholesterol and higher plasma concentration of total cholesterol and Low-density lipoprotein (LDL) cholesterol and triglycerides(TG) as compared to low and medium consumer of red meat as well as vegans and vegetarians. There have also been studies showing significant relation between red meat and risk of colon cancer. Cooking red meat at higher temperature leads to the development of mutagenic compounds such as HCAs and polycyclic aromatic hydrocarbons (PAHs) which are responsible for various cancers. There are also evidences that show the saturated fatty acid content in red meat can be linked with chronic heart diseases. (McAfee et al., 2010) Summary Red meat is a rich source of nutritionally rich compounds which are essential in a human diet. Meat is a potent source of protein and it supplies the major amino acids that cannot be synthesized by the body termed as essential amino acids. The nutrient composition of meat includes fat, essential amino acids, vitamins, minerals and trace elements that makes it an inevitable part of human diet. Certain studies do show red meat is harmful when consumed in higher amounts and when cooked at higher temperatures, hence a proper monitoring on the cooking practices and consumption of red meat is essential to maintain a healthy diet. Sociology is the study of society and people. Food and food ways are often elements associated with particular societies and therefore, studying such a topic can offer valuable insight into the ways of that society and the people who live in it. Although eating is a vital part of survival, with whom, how and where we eat are not. Studying such ways can illustrate and represent the identity of a person or group. The nature of people and their beliefs can be indicated when analysing their food habits. Who individuals eat with is a particularly revealing factor into gaining an understanding of their identity, culture and society (Scholliers P 2001). For this reason commensality is a term frequently used in sociological research concerning food and food ways. Commensality can be defined as the notion of eating with others. It is the act of two or more people consuming a meal together (Pearsall J 1999). The purpose of commensality is much more than that of allowing survival. It pushes beyond this and becomes a practice of socialisation. Anthropologist Martin Sahlins suggested that not only does it provide opportunities for people to integrate socially, but that it can be the starting factor and maintaining factor in which enables relationships to form and develop. For example, he found that at the beginning of relationship formation commensality tends to involve the sharing of drinks and snacks. As relationships develop the meals become more complex. He claimed that the traditional cooked dinner of meats and vegetables is one mainly shared among families and rarely with friends (Lupton 1996). A flame test is used to identify certain metals in a compound or single element.1 When an electron jumps up to a higher energy state the element is in its excited state. Elements are only in their excited for a brief moment. When the electron moves back down to a lower energy state, it emits light and produce a flame color.1 Sometimes there is more than one flame color because an electron might go from the 4s orbital then go to the 2p orbital which means two colors will be produced. Every element emits a different flame color or colors. These colors can be put on a bright line spectra which shows every color that the element produces in a flame test.1 Each element has a unique bright line spectra and thus can be identified by using its bright line spectra. When the element is in a compound, it can be burned to produce the flame. The color of the flame corresponds with each element. When there is an unknown compound, the metal can be found by using previous data from previous tests. By looking at the color you can see if it matches any previous tests and possibly find the name of the metal. Flame tests can also be used to find the color of fireworks one wants to use. By using the metal that emits the color one wants in fireworks, one can get the desired color.
